In humans this protein is encoded by the VPS51 gene. This protein is known to act as component of the GARP complex that is involved in retrograde transport from early and late endosomes to the trans-Golgi network (TGN). The canonical protein structure is reported to have an amino acid length of 782 residues, a mass of 86 kDa, and is a member of the VPS51 protein family. Its subcellular location is known to be in the golgi. As many as 2 protein isoforms have been reported. The gene encoding this protein has been associated with the disease, Pontocerebellar hypoplasia. This protein may also be known as ANG3, C11orf3, FFR, PCH13, and ANG2.
